
This year, it was "A Day in the Life of an Elf!" and it was sooooo cute! They showed the elfs doing various chores at Santa's estate in the North Pole. They had them baking cookies, working in the toy workshop, going to school, sleeping and singing carols. They also had a majestic forest of singing Christmas trees.

It was so cool to see the children just fascinated by all of the cool things to look at! Logan was thrilled because everything was just about his size. He wanted so badly to climb up on the displays and play around in the kitchen or climb up onto one of the elf bunk beds. He did an amazing job of restraining himself and just looking with his "looking eyes."

Lily was tired by the time we got up to the display so she was a little cranky. We did have to wait in line for about 20 minutes before making it inside but once we were actually going through it she was OK. She wanted to get down and touch and being a two year old couldn't understand why we weren't allowing her to touch all the pretty things.

It was a very successful trip and even though Lily was a little too young to understand the concept of just looking at all the rooms I think she enjoyed what she saw. I know that next year it will be even more memorable. I've heard that Macy's is going to stop doing the holiday display so I wanted to take my kids to it at least once just in case they decide to discontinue this wonderful tradition. I really hope that they decide to do it every year but I guess we will have to wait and see. What is that saying again? Oh yeah, "All good things must end." I'm just wishing it would end 50 years from now!
